F250 dying on me
 
No check engine light. If I cruise along at an idle, and then give it gas. It dies. 94 250 5.8 liter. It always starts right back up. I took it to my local mechanic. No codes. He cleaned the throttle body and checked the fuel pressure. It's still doing it. Any suggestions? This is really bothersome when I am driving slow like when driving the pipeline trail out to my remote cabin. It's very rough and I have to creep along. Dies almost every time I step on the gas.

unplug iac and see if there is a difference. Some say you can clean them, I fried one trying to clean it. New motorcraft plugs, and new msd wires, cap, and rotor is what these trucks like. Stocks cats do suck on these. If you have a good welder buddy, you can get catco 2.5" highflow cats cheap off ebay. Have one welded into your factory y pipe. If you don't have the factory cats you can remove the pulley off the smog pump and run a shorter belt. Or just leave it as is, doesn't matter.
